The product is very heavy duty and of high quality. Included are knock outs on the cover. For the pictures I have included, I have used 4/0 battery cables with 3/8 crimp on connectors for reference. I also drilled out and slightly enlarged my 3/8 crimp on connectors to fit onto these lugs.
